Transaction 5d45668575caf51a633ef0799c5fa4f1957e30e05f2a1451e44b53ca29f688ea
1 Input
1 Output
-
5d45668575caf51a633ef0799c5fa4f1957e30e05f2a1451e44b53ca29f688ea:0
- value
- 53000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8959d5390ee17edec281e867acf9a79f4a07a8a82e2ca830659a508c88f9e4a2
- address
- tb1p39va2wgwu9ldas5papn6e7d8na9q029g9ck2svr9nfggez8euj3q0gmg20